In article <312256D9 DOT C42 AT nlthcl DOT bcs DOT cs DOT philips DOT com> tms_hennuin AT nlthcl DOT bcs DOT cs DOT philips DOT com "Henk Hennuin" writes: > > This is probably a newby question but I couldn't find the answer in > the FAQ. > > Last week I downloaded EZ-GCC this is DJGPP v1.12m4 for > easy installation and minimum diskspace. > > I have installed the 3 disk set onto my computer and tried > my first little C++ program. So far so good. > > Now my problem: > > I have trouble with the cout iostream function. Everything seems to > work allright but just this one thing doesn't. > > The compiler doesn't complain. The linker gives these errors: > > test.cc(.text+0xa5): undefined reference to `endl(ostream &)' > test.cc(.text+0xaa): undefined reference to `cout' > test.cc(.text+0xaf): undefined reference to `ostream::operator<<(ostream > &(*)(ostream &))' > > The last error message I managed to get rid of by using the -O flag > with gcc. This tip I go from the FAQ, it has got something to do with > optimalisation and inline code. > > Does anybody know how I can solve the other two? I had a similar problem when I started using the DJGPP compiler. I found that I needed to link in the libgpl library with -lgpl.
